An opinion piece in today's "Der Standard" quotes Leonard's "The Future" in connection with the crisis in Crimea:

http://dastandard.at/1395363328826/

A translation of the beginning of the article:

GIVE ME BACK THE BERLIN WALL

"The west" reinvents itself with Russia again taking the role of the bogeyman and asserts its moral superiority

"Give me back the Berlin wall," Leonard Cohen sang in the year 1992. The dystopian song "The Future", conjuring up the apocalypse, goes on to say: "Things are gonna slide, slide in all directions (...) Won't be nothing (...) you can measure anymore". 22 years later, one cannot deny Cohen's lyrics a certain political relevance.

Since the outbreak of the Crimean crisis, the Cold War has undegrone a revival : on the one hand as a specter, often raised with the refrain of "hopefully never again ...", on the other, as an option, that can, given recent events, be not dismissed entirely. Before 1989, the competitive systems had brought a certain predictability and stability. Against the backdrop of a sudden rush of events, a balance of terror would be preferable to an impending escalation.

Of course, a resurgence of the Cold War is neither feasible nor desirable, and yet many Western media and politicians are in the middle in such a resurgence. The media-fueled unease , in other words "Russia -bashing ", is experiencing a new golden age, which hasn't been the case in such a unilateral way for a long time. Russia is often conviniently used as a projection which allows "the West" to celebrate its own moral superiority. Facts play a subordinate role.
